Tactical Air Support Inc. Quality Assurance Representative Salary $45.00 - $50.00/hourly DOE Position Summary Tactical Air is currently seeking a Quality Assurance Representative to join our team. This position will support Tactical Air's fleet of fighter aircraft with over 75 years of combined experience in tactical aviation maintenance and more than 30 years of military adversary contract maintenance. The Maintenance staff are a dedicated team comprised of experienced, A&P-certified, and tactical aircraft mechanics, technicians, and logisticians who all work towards ensuring safe and seamless ground maintenance operations. Responsibilities The ideal candidate for the Quality Assurance Representative position will report to the Site Manager, and Quality Assurance Manager. They will be responsible to monitor and evaluate all maintenance actions and training to ensure safe and reliable aircraft are provided in accordance with current technical manuals, directives, and instructions applicable to the maintenance program.
